Estou com uma dificuldade em encontrar informações sobre INNER JOIN e JOIN, digo, informações básicas tem...
Tenho uma tabela que contém o índice tipo:
ÍNDICE e NOME
Em outra tabela eu tenho o índice para poder cruzar a referência (ÍNDICE) e outro campo (EMAIL)
até ai tudo bem, usando um INNER JOIN entre as duas tabelas eu consigo o resultado numa boa, porém, ao adicionar mais de um email para o mesmo índice, eu vou ter mais de uma vez todos os resultados, exemplo de um resultado de pesquisa:
ID | NOME | EMAIL
1 - Samir - samir@dominio.com
1 - Samir - samir@dominio2.com
2 - João - joao@dominio.com
Como eu poderia fazer para limitar esta pesquisa, a pegar apenas 1 resultado da tabela email?
Eu tentei com o LIMIT, porém só é possível usar o LIMIT após o cruzamento das tabelas, e com isto o LIMIT irá limitar todos os meus resultado e não apenas a tabela email; pode ter ficado estranho o que eu escrevi, qualquer coisa é só dizer que eu posto mais detalhes.
Muito obrigado
Pessoal, desculpa eu sei que postei no lugar errado, eu estava com o problema na cabeça que acabei nem postando corretamente o post.
Pergunta
Samir
Estou com uma dificuldade em encontrar informações sobre INNER JOIN e JOIN, digo, informações básicas tem...
Tenho uma tabela que contém o índice tipo:
ÍNDICE e NOME
Em outra tabela eu tenho o índice para poder cruzar a referência (ÍNDICE) e outro campo (EMAIL)
até ai tudo bem, usando um INNER JOIN entre as duas tabelas eu consigo o resultado numa boa, porém, ao adicionar mais de um email para o mesmo índice, eu vou ter mais de uma vez todos os resultados, exemplo de um resultado de pesquisa:
ID | NOME | EMAIL
1 - Samir - samir@dominio.com
1 - Samir - samir@dominio2.com
2 - João - joao@dominio.com
Como eu poderia fazer para limitar esta pesquisa, a pegar apenas 1 resultado da tabela email?
Eu tentei com o LIMIT, porém só é possível usar o LIMIT após o cruzamento das tabelas, e com isto o LIMIT irá limitar todos os meus resultado e não apenas a tabela email; pode ter ficado estranho o que eu escrevi, qualquer coisa é só dizer que eu posto mais detalhes.
Muito obrigado
Pessoal, desculpa eu sei que postei no lugar errado, eu estava com o problema na cabeça que acabei nem postando corretamente o post.
O link do local correto:
http://scriptbrasil.com.br/forum/index.php?showtopic=155273
Obrigado e desculpa o transtorno!
Editado por SamirLink para o comentário
Compartilhar em outros sites
2 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.